Analisis dan Perancangan Jaringan Komputer I

25 Februari 2011, Jum’at –> Pertemuan ke-1

Tugas :

2 Jenis Processor

1.  CISC adalah singkatan dari Complex Intruction Set Computer dimana prosesor tersebut memiliki set instruksi yang kompleks dan lengkap.

CISC dimaksudkan untuk meminimumkan jumlah perintah yang diperlukan untuk mengerjakan  pekerjaan yang diberikan. (Jumlah perintah sedikit tetapi rumit). Konsep CISC menjadikan  mesin mudah untuk diprogram dalam bahasa rakitan, tetapi konsep ini menyulitkan dalam  penyusunan compiler bahasa pemrograman tingkat tinggi. Dalam CISC banyak terdapat perintah  bahasa mesin. CISC memiliki set instruksi yang kompleks dan lengkap, dan dirasa berpengaruh pada kinerjanya  yang lebih lambat. CISC menawarkan set instruksi yang powerful kuat, tangguh, maka tidak heran jika CISC memang hanya mengenal bahasa assembly yang sebenarnya ditujukan bagi para programmer. Oleh karena itu, CISC memerlukan sedikit instruksi untuk berjalan. Jadi sebenarnya tujuan utama dari arsitektur CISC adalah melaksanakan suatu perintah cukup dengan beberapa baris bahasa mesin sedikit mungkin.

2. RISC adalah singkatan dari Reduced Instruction Set Computer yang artinya prosesor tersebut memiliki set instruksi program yang lebih sedikit.

Konsep RISC menyederhanakan rumusan perintah sehingga lebih efisien dalam  penyusunan kompiler yang pada akhirnya dapat memaksimumkan kinerja program yang ditulis  dalam bahasa tingkat tinggi. Arsitektur RISC banyak menerapkan proses eksekusi pipeline. Meskipun jumlah perintah tunggal yang diperlukan untuk melakukan pekerjaan yang diberikan mungkin lebih besar, eksekusi secara pipeline memerlukan waktu yang lebih singkat daripada  waktu untuk melakukan pekerjaan yang sama dengan menggunakan perintah yang lebih rumit. Mesin RISC memerlukan memori yang lebih besar untuk mengakomodasi program yang lebih besar. IBM 801 adalah prosesor komersial pertama yang menggunakan pendekatan RISC.

Ciri-ciri RISC :

• Instruksi berukuran tunggal Ukuran yang umum adalah 4 byte

• Jumlah mode pengalamatan data yang sedikit, biasanya kurang dari lima buah

• Tidak terdapat pengalamatan tak langsung

• Tidak terdapat operasi yang menggabungkan operasi load/store dengan operasi aritmatika

(misalnya, penambahan dari memori, penambahan ke memori)

Perbedaan RISC dengan CISC

RISC ( Reduced Instruction Set Computer )

– Menekankan pada perangkat lunak, dengan sedikit transistor

– Instruksi sederhana bahkan single

– Load / Store atau memory ke memory bekerja terpisah

– Ukuran kode besar dan kecapatan lebih tinggi

– Transistor didalamnya lebih untuk meregister memori

– chipnya dilengkapi dengan sistem superscalar, pipelining, cachesmemory, register-register yang bertujuan untuk mempercepat kinerja processor

CISC ( Complex Instruction Set Computer )

– Lebih menekankan pada perangkat keras, sesuai dengan takdirnya untuk pragramer.

– Memiliki instruksi komplek. Load / Store atau Memori ke Memori bekerjasama

– Memiliki ukuran kode yang kecil dan kecepatan yang rendah.

– Transistor di dalamnya digunakan untuk menyimpan instruksi – instruksi bersifat komplek

– memiliki microcode berupa firmware internal didalam chipnya yang berguna untuk menerjemahkan instruksi makro. Ini dapat memperlambat eksekusi instruksi namun efektif membuat instruksi yang kompleks.

Gambar Motherboard

 


Leave a Reply

Fill in your details below or click an icon to log in: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out / Change )

Twitter picture

You are commenting using your Twitter account. Log Out / Change )

Facebook photo

You are commenting using your Facebook account. Log Out / Change )

Google+ photo

You are commenting using your Google+ account. Log Out / Change )

Connecting to %s

%d bloggers like this: